Frontier Airlines flight kills a pedestrian on runway during takeoff

An unsettling incident unfolded on a Frontier Airlines flight en route to Los Angeles when it fatally struck a person on the runway at Denver International Airport on Friday night. The unexpected tragedy left passengers and crew members in shock.

According to a statement from Denver International Airport, the individual had reportedly ‘jumped the perimeter fence’ near the runway. Just two minutes later, at 11:19 p.m. local time, the person was hit by the approaching aircraft.

The unidentified person, who authorities believe was not an airport employee, tragically lost their life in the accident. Details regarding their identity remain unknown at this time.

ABC News reported that the individual was at least partially ingested by one of the engines of Frontier Flight 4345. Photographs that surfaced on social media, which have not been published by the Daily Mail, showed visible blood on the affected engine of the Airbus A321.

Among the passengers was Mohamed Hassan, who recounted the harrowing experience in an interview with NBC’s Denver affiliate KUSA. “Honestly, it was the scariest experience of my life,” Hassan expressed. “I was on the flight and I looked to my right and I just saw a fire, I heard a loud boom, and people started screaming.”

‘I thought I was going to die,’ he said.

Hassan added that he and the others on board were stuck on the plane for about three minutes before the evacuation began. He said he inhaled ‘a lot of toxic fumes’ and that passengers were screaming.

Videos posted to social media showed passengers escaping from the cabin via the emergency slides. In one clip, a child could be seen jumping on to the slide. All 224 passengers and seven crew members got off the plane by slide.

There were at least 12 minor injuries among those on the aircraft and five people were transported to local hospitals. The rest of the passengers were bussed to the terminal and have since left on a new Frontier flight. 

Secretary of Transportation Sean Duffy described the person who was hit as a ‘trespasser’ who breached airport security before deliberately scaling the fence. Officials who examined the fence said it was intact. 

Duffy added on X: ‘No one should EVER trespass on an airport.’

In a statement to the Daily Mail, Frontier Airlines confirmed the event and said it was investigating what happened. 

Air traffic control audio from ATC.com picked up the crew speaking about the incident.

‘Tower, Frontier 4345, we’re stopping on the runway. Uh, we just hit somebody… we have an engine fire,’ the pilot was heard saying.

When asked how many people were on board, the pilot said: ‘We have 231 souls on board… There was an individual walking across the runway.’

The pilot then said there was smoke on the aircraft and that they’d need to evacuate the passengers and crew.

The Denver Fire Department responded to the scene and put out the fire.

Frontier and the Federal Aviation Administration are investigating. The National Transportation Safety Board is also aware of the incident.

Runway 17L, where the collision occurred, reopened at 10.55am Saturday.
